The first step is you must click the Windows button and search for the control panel. Now access the control panel of your computer and click the search bar located in the upper right-hand corner.

You can now search “JAVA” in the search bar. After exploring it, click on the JAVA icon.

Go to the Java tab, and you will see several options. One of the “runtime parameters” is empty; therefore, paste this formula “-Xincgc -Xmx2048M” in runtime parameters, click Add, and click apply.

This technique helps you run Minecraft more smoothly on your PC. If you’re not successful, try the next step.
